Mint Paneer Tikka

Homemade Mint Paneer Tikka recipe

Homemade Mint Paneer Tikka recipe

Paneer or Cottage Cheese is a fresh cheese common in South Asian Cuisine.Mint Paneer tikka is so delicious and healthy.Traditionally,Tikkas are grilled in a tandoor and the dish is thereafter served hot.
Here,to make Paneer tikka,I used Table top Grill,which gives almost same texture to the tikka as it is made in tandoor.We can even use grilling pan,on stove top.

Ingredients
Paneer- 200 g
Ginger Garlic Paste-1-2 tsp
Carom seeds(ajwain)-1 tsp
Mint leaves -a handful
Kasuri Methi( Dried Fenugreek Leaves)- 1 -2 tsp 
Bell peppers,Onion Rings-
Salt- to taste
Yogurt-1/2 cup
Red chilly powder- 2-3 tsp
Chaat Masala(I used,Sindhi Biriyani Masala,it was what available at home :-) gives the same restaurant paneer tikka taste).
Method Of Preparation
For Marinade
Make a paste with all the ingredients except paneer.
Cut Paneer into thick square/rectangle pieces .
Paneer or Cottage cheese
Apply the marinade and keep this refrigerated for at least 1/2 an hour.

Grill and serve hot. We can also serve this as a starter/appetizer.

World Health Day -7th April.

The World Health Organisation (WHO) observes APRIL 7 as the World Health Day   to draw attention to their priorities for global health.April 7 is also the anniversary of founding of WHO in 1948. This year their slogan of the day is : "Good health adds life to years".This shows how good health through out life can help older men and women lead full and productive lives. So,this year 2012,WHO highlights "Ageing and Health" as their theme for Global Health Day. Above picture is  an 87 year old man jumping head first from high altitudes.
